Installation Precautions for CNC Vertical Turning Milling Machines

Unpacking

After the machine is unpacked, first find the random technical file according to the packaging mark, and check the accessories, tools, spare parts, etc. according to the packing list in the technical file. If the actual item in the box does not match the packing list, you should contact the manufacturer in time. Then, read the instructions carefully and follow the instructions for installation.

Hoisting

According to the hoisting diagram in the manual, padded wooden blocks or thick cloth at appropriate positions to prevent the wire rope from scratching the paint and processing surface. In the lifting process, the center of gravity of the machine tool should be reduced as much as possible. If the electric tortoise of the CNC machine tool is separated, there is usually a hoisting ring on the top of the electric cabinet for hoisting.

Adjustment

For the CNC vertical turning milling machine, the main machine is shipped as a whole machine, and it is adjusted before leaving the factory. The user should pay attention to the installation: adjustment of oil pressure, adjustment of automatic lubrication, and focus on checking whether the device for preventing vertical sliding of the lifting platform works Wait.

Q: What is the difference between CNC milling and CNC turning?

A: CNC milling gets rid of material from your workpiece by using multi-point cutting tools. These tools include face mills, drills, and end mills. They can handle different tasks like slotting, drilling, etc. On the other hand, CNC turning removes material by using single-cutting tools.

Q: What is the Difference Between CNC Turning Centers and CNC lathes?

A: CNC turning centers are more advanced forms of CNC lathes. Both are machine tools that rotate a bar of material, allowing the cutting tool to remove material from the bar until the desired product is remaining. However, lathes are typically only 2 axis machines and have just one spindle, whereas turning centers can have up to 5 axes and are far more versatile in terms of cutting ability.
